Recommended Reading for Parents and TeensThank you to the Livingston Parents Self-Help Support group for compiling a terrific reading list (click on link above) for parents of challenging tweens and teens. The link about lists books are which are available for loan through the Livingston Self-Help Support Group for participants.The Livingston Parents Self-Help Support group is a confidential and anonymous support group for parents. It is facilitated by parents for parents regarding raising children and teens who are not typical and who struggle with personal and familial challenges -- including, but not limited to, Substance Abuse. The Livingston Parents Self-Help Support group has been in existence for 30 years. Meetings are held at the Livingston Community and Senior Center in Multi-purpose Room 2 every Tuesday from 7:45 pm - 10:00 pm. Anyone is welcome to attend their meetings - which are free of charge.
